You can save a chord progression to tape (PS-800) or to MIDI (PS800-II
and EX800). Which is awful but it works.
Only the single note that is held down is sent to MIDI.
A few people have asked me to add a feature to the HAWK that will play
all of the chord notes. I shall have another look and see how feasible
that is.
